# If we are running with fakeroot on Linux, then use the xattr functions of fakeroot. This is needed by
# the 'test_extract_capabilities' test, but also allows xattrs to work with fakeroot on Linux in normal use.
# TODO: Check whether fakeroot supports xattrs on all platforms supported below.
# TODO: If that's the case then we can make Borg fakeroot-xattr-compatible on these as well.
XATTR_FAKEROOT = False
if sys.platform.startswith("linux"):
LD_PRELOAD = os.environ.get("LD_PRELOAD", "")
preloads = re.split("[ :]", LD_PRELOAD)
for preload in preloads:
if preload.startswith("libfakeroot"):
env = prepare_subprocess_env(system=True)
fakeroot_output = subprocess.check_output(["fakeroot", "-v"], env=env)

fakeroot_version = parse_version(fakeroot_output.decode("ascii").split()[-1])
if fakeroot_version >= parse_version("1.20.2"):
# 1.20.2 has been confirmed to have xattr support
# 1.18.2 has been confirmed not to have xattr support
# Versions in-between are unknown
XATTR_FAKEROOT = True
break
def is_enabled(path=None):
"""Determine if xattr is enabled on the filesystem"""
with tempfile.NamedTemporaryFile(dir=path, prefix="borg-tmp") as f:
fd = f.fileno()
name, value = b"user.name", b"value"
try:
setxattr(fd, name, value)
except OSError:
return False
try:
names = listxattr(fd)
except OSError:
return False
if name not in names:
return False
return getxattr(fd, name) == value

def get_all(path, follow_symlinks=False):
2017-05-20 14:40:36 +00:00
"""
Return all extended attributes on *path* as a mapping.
*path* can either be a path (str or bytes) or an open file descriptor (int).
*follow_symlinks* indicates whether symlinks should be followed
and only applies when *path* is not an open file descriptor.
The returned mapping maps xattr names (bytes) to values (bytes or None).

None indicates, as a xattr value, an empty value, i.e. a value of length zero.
"""
if isinstance(path, str):
path = os.fsencode(path)
result = {}
try:
names = listxattr(path, follow_symlinks=follow_symlinks)
for name in names:
try:
# xattr name is a bytes object, we directly use it.
result[name] = getxattr(path, name, follow_symlinks=follow_symlinks)
except OSError as e:
# note: platform.xattr._check has already made a nice exception e with errno, msg, path/fd
if e.errno in (ENOATTR,): # errors we just ignore silently
# ENOATTR: a race has happened: xattr names were deleted after list.
pass
else: # all others: warn, skip this single xattr name, continue processing other xattrs
# EPERM: we were not permitted to read this attribute
# EINVAL: maybe xattr name is invalid or other issue, #6988
logger.warning("when getting extended attribute %s: %s", name.decode(errors="replace"), str(e))
except OSError as e:
if e.errno in (errno.ENOTSUP, errno.EPERM):
# if xattrs are not supported on the filesystem, we give up.
# EPERM might be raised by listxattr.
pass
else:
raise
return result
def set_all(path, xattrs, follow_symlinks=False):
"""
Set all extended attributes on *path* from a mapping.
*path* can either be a path (str or bytes) or an open file descriptor (int).
*follow_symlinks* indicates whether symlinks should be followed
and only applies when *path* is not an open file descriptor.
*xattrs* is mapping maps xattr names (bytes) to values (bytes or None).
None indicates, as a xattr value, an empty value, i.e. a value of length zero.
Return warning status (True means a non-fatal exception has happened and was dealt with).
"""
if isinstance(path, str):
path = os.fsencode(path)
warning = False
for k, v in xattrs.items():
try:
setxattr(path, k, v, follow_symlinks=follow_symlinks)
except OSError as e:
# note: platform.xattr._check has already made a nice exception e with errno, msg, path/fd
warning = True
if e.errno == errno.E2BIG:
err_str = "too big for this filesystem (%s)" % str(e)
elif e.errno == errno.ENOSPC:
# ext4 reports ENOSPC when trying to set an xattr with >4kiB while ext4 can only support 4kiB xattrs
# (in this case, this is NOT a "disk full" error, just a ext4 limitation).
err_str = "fs full or xattr too big? [xattr len = %d] (%s)" % (len(v), str(e))
else:

# generic handler
# EACCES: permission denied to set this specific xattr (this may happen related to security.* keys)
# EPERM: operation not permitted
err_str = str(e)
logger.warning("when setting extended attribute %s: %s", k.decode(errors="replace"), err_str)
return warning
